Vaga de Especialista de Engenharia de Software I
1 vaga: | Publicada em 16/04
- A Combinar
Sobre a vaga
O UOL EdTech, maior empresa de tecnologia para educação do Brasil, promove
soluções inovadoras para as maiores empresas e instituições de ensino superior do
país. Acreditamos que o presente da Educação é Digital! Aqui trabalhamos em times
multidisciplinares, cultivamos uma filosofia de trabalho ágil, enxuto e estamos em
busca de um profissional que tenha #PaixaoPorAprender, que seja #Ousado, tenha
#FocoEmResultados e que queira fazer parte de uma #RevoluçãoNaEducação. Se você
tem este perfil e está em busca de novos desafios, venha fazer parte do nosso time
e desenvolver sua carreira numa das áreas que prometem grandes disrupções nos
próximos anos #edtech. #VemProUOLEdTech! No UOL EdTech todas as pessoas são
bem-vindas
, sem distinção de gênero, orientação sexual, etnia, cultura,
religião, deficiência etc . O importante é você gostar de desafios, trabalhar bem
em equipe, vivenciar nossa cultura e nossa missão de inovar e revolucionar a
educação online no Brasil para gerar oportunidades e transformar vidas.
Informações adicionais:
Liderar tecnicamente um time multidisciplinar de Engenharia de Software, Devops e
Qualidade. Zelar pelo ambiente em produção, prestando cuidados especiais ao uso
eficiente dos recursos e à escalabilidade e estabilidade do sistema, bem como
definindo métricas técnicas para tais sistemas. Garantir que o time desenvolve com
excelência técnica entregando um código limpo, com baixa proporção de bugs, boa
cobertura de testes, melhores práticas e padrões sem desrespeitar o tempo
estimado. Guiar o time para a construção de soluções e arquitetura dos sistemas,
além de ser responsável técnico das soluções finais. Conduzir mentorias técnicas e
feedback técnicos com os membros do time. Interagir com outras lideranças técnicas
para avaliar soluções e garantir que o sistema de seu time esteja adequado aos
demais sistemas da empresa. Mapear oportunidades de soluções e roadmap técnico do
time. Identificar riscos técnicos dos projetos. Sólida experiência no ecossistema
Javascript (React, React Native e NodeJs). Familiaridade com desenvolvimento de
ponta a ponta de sistemas. Experiência com a configuração, testes, monitoramento,
otimização, escala e automatização de novas tecnologias. Experiência com ambiente
cloud (AWS, GCP ou Azure). Entender como os bancos de dados relacionais funcionam
e ser capaz de modelar e consultar um banco de dados. Familiaridade com CI/CD
(integração e entrega contínuas). Conhecimento em princípios e padrões de
qualidade software. Familiaridade com diferentes tipos de testes automáticos
(unitário, integração, componente e ponta a ponta). Experiência com monitoramento
e investigação de bugs e problemas. Conhecimento em programação orientada a
objetos. Conhecimento em REST Apis. Familiaridade com arquitetura de micro
serviços e orientada a eventos. Conhecimento em desenvolvimento ágil e protótipos
rápidos.